[0022] Preparation of PPIP
[0023]
[0024] Add 0.2g o-phenanthroline dione, 0.113mL p-tolualdehyde, 0.103mL aniline, 5mL glacial acetic acid, 0.88g ammonium acetate into a 100mL schlenk bottle. Reflux reaction for 5-24h. Add the reaction solution dropwise to the base solution and 50mL of chloroform, adjust the pH value of the solution to about 7. Extract after standing still. Extract the aqueous layer twice with chloroform, and wash the combined chloroform layer with water twice. Tetrahydrofuran was used as the eluent for chromatographic column separation to obtain 0.298 g of a light yellow solid with a yield of 81.2%. 1 HNMR (CDCl 3 ,400MHz)δ(ppm):9.190-9.139(m,2H),9.031-9.042(m,1H),7.731-7.762(m,1H),7.617-7.676(m,3H),7.518-7.535(d, 2),7.415-7.476(m,3H),7.260-7.292(m,1H),7.102-7.122(d,2),2.333(s,3H).MS(ESI + ):found386.2;calcd.for[C 26 h 18 N 4 ] / z386.1.
